What Is Berberine?
Berberine is a naturally occurring alkaloid — a nitrogen-containing plant compound — found in the roots, bark, and stems of several plants: Berberis vulgaris (barberry), Hydrastis canadensis (goldenseal), Coptis chinensis (goldthread), Oregon grape, and tree turmeric (Berberis aristata), among others. Its distinctive bright yellow color has been used as a natural dye for centuries.
In traditional Chinese medicine, berberine has been used for more than 400 years primarily to treat gastrointestinal infections, diarrhea, and inflammation. In Ayurvedic practice, it appears in formulations targeting metabolic and digestive health. Source: Cleveland Clinic
Modern science has revealed why berberine works so broadly: it activates AMP-activated protein kinase (AMPK), an enzyme often described as the body’s master metabolic regulator. AMPK acts like a cellular energy sensor — when activated, it improves glucose uptake, enhances insulin sensitivity, inhibits fat synthesis, and promotes mitochondrial efficiency. This single mechanism explains berberine’s wide-ranging effects on blood sugar, weight, heart health, and longevity pathways.
A December 2025 review published in Pharmaceuticals (PMC) called berberine “a rising star in the management of type 2 diabetes” and highlighted novel insights into its anti-inflammatory, metabolic, and epigenetic mechanisms — noting that its multi-pathway activity makes it particularly valuable for metabolic syndrome, where several systems are dysregulated simultaneously. 7 Science-Backed Berberine Benefits
1. Blood Sugar Control and Insulin Resistance
Evidence rating: Strong
This is berberine’s most clinically documented benefit and the area with the most robust human trial data. Berberine lowers blood sugar through multiple simultaneous mechanisms: it activates AMPK to improve insulin sensitivity, slows carbohydrate absorption in the gut, reduces glucose production in the liver (hepatic gluconeogenesis), and increases glucose uptake in muscle cells.
A comprehensive systematic review and meta-analysis of randomized clinical trials published in Frontiers in Pharmacology (PMC) evaluated berberine’s efficacy across multiple metabolic disorders. The analysis confirmed that berberine alone produced statistically significant reductions in fasting blood glucose, postprandial blood glucose (blood sugar after meals), and HbA1c (the 3-month average blood sugar marker). Ohio State University’s Wexner Medical Center notes that berberine activates the same AMPK pathway as metformin, which is why researchers have compared the two compounds. Registered dietitian and diabetes educator Alma Simmons confirms that berberine has been shown to lower blood sugar and improve insulin sensitivity, though she emphasizes it is a dietary supplement — not a medication — and should not replace prescribed treatments without medical guidance. 2. Weight Loss and Body Composition
Evidence rating: Moderate to Strong
Berberine’s weight loss effects are real, but context matters. It does not produce dramatic weight loss on its own — but it consistently reduces visceral fat (the metabolically dangerous fat stored around internal organs), improves insulin sensitivity, and modestly reduces total body weight in people with metabolic dysfunction.
A multicenter, double-blind randomized clinical trial published in JAMA Network Open in 2025 evaluated berberine (1g/day) versus placebo in diabetes-free individuals with obesity and metabolic dysfunction-associated steatotic liver disease (MASLD). The berberine group showed significant reductions in visceral adipose tissue area and liver fat content compared to placebo, along with improvements in glucose, lipid, and inflammation parameters over 6 months. Source: JAMA Network Open

3. Heart Health and Cholesterol
Evidence rating: Moderate to Strong
Berberine improves multiple cardiovascular risk markers: it lowers LDL cholesterol, reduces triglycerides, raises HDL cholesterol, and may strengthen the cardiac muscle — making it relevant for both metabolic heart disease prevention and direct cardiovascular support.
The Frontiers in Pharmacology meta-analysis confirmed that berberine produced significant improvements in lipid profiles across multiple randomized trials — with consistent reductions in total cholesterol, LDL, and triglycerides. Source: PMC/NIH
WebMD notes that berberine may help strengthen the heartbeat and shows promise for certain heart conditions — particularly in the context of metabolic syndrome where insulin resistance, high triglycerides, and cardiovascular risk overlap. Source: WebMD
Berberine also inhibits PCSK9 — a protein that reduces the liver’s ability to clear LDL from the blood — which is the same mechanism targeted by a newer class of cholesterol drugs (PCSK9 inhibitors). This cholesterol-lowering pathway is entirely independent of its AMPK effects, making berberine particularly valuable for people with elevated LDL alongside metabolic dysfunction.
4. Gut Microbiome Support
Evidence rating: Moderate
One of berberine’s most underappreciated mechanisms is its direct effect on the gut microbiome. Berberine selectively inhibits the growth of harmful gut bacteria while supporting beneficial strains — shifting the microbiome toward a composition associated with better metabolic health, reduced inflammation, and improved gut barrier integrity.
This gut-modulating effect is partly why berberine’s metabolic benefits are so broad — the gut microbiome influences insulin sensitivity, fat storage signaling, inflammation, and even mood. By improving microbial balance, berberine creates a downstream improvement in multiple systems simultaneously.
The December 2025 PMC review highlighted berberine’s epigenetic and microbiome mechanisms as an emerging area of research — noting that berberine’s interaction with gut bacteria may explain some of its anti-obesity and anti-diabetic effects that go beyond AMPK activation alone. Source: PMC/NIH

5. PCOS and Hormonal Balance
Evidence rating: Moderate
Polycystic ovary syndrome (PCOS) is driven in large part by insulin resistance — making berberine directly relevant. By improving insulin sensitivity, berberine reduces the hyperinsulinemia that drives excess androgen production in PCOS, potentially improving menstrual regularity, reducing testosterone levels, and supporting fertility.
Multiple clinical trials have compared berberine to metformin specifically in women with PCOS — finding comparable effects on insulin resistance, androgen levels, and metabolic markers, with berberine showing a favorable side effect profile.
UCLA Health notes that berberine’s potential goes far beyond weight loss — and that its effects on hormonal regulation and reproductive health are an active area of research, with researchers working to understand its full scope. Source: UCLA Health
For women with PCOS who cannot tolerate metformin’s GI side effects, berberine represents a well-tolerated natural alternative that addresses the same underlying insulin-resistance mechanism.
6. Anti-Inflammatory Effects
Evidence rating: Moderate
Berberine suppresses multiple pro-inflammatory pathways — particularly NF-kB, the same master inflammatory switch that omega-3s and curcumin target. By inhibiting NF-kB signaling, berberine reduces the production of inflammatory cytokines including TNF-alpha, IL-6, and IL-1beta.
The JAMA Network Open trial confirmed that berberine supplementation produced significant improvements in inflammation parameters alongside its metabolic effects — suggesting that its anti-inflammatory activity operates in parallel with, not just downstream of, its blood sugar and fat-reduction mechanisms. Source: JAMA Network Open
The December 2025 PMC review specifically highlighted berberine’s anti-inflammatory and epigenetic mechanisms as distinguishing features — noting that it influences gene expression in ways that reduce chronic inflammatory signaling over time. Source: PMC/NIH

7. Longevity and Anti-Aging
Evidence rating: Emerging
AMPK activation — berberine’s primary mechanism — is one of the most studied longevity pathways in biology. AMPK activation mimics the cellular effects of caloric restriction and exercise on aging, triggering autophagy (the body’s cellular cleanup process), improving mitochondrial function, and reducing the accumulation of cellular damage that drives aging.
Berberine also inhibits mTOR (mechanistic target of rapamycin) — another key longevity pathway that, when overactivated, accelerates cellular aging. This dual AMPK activation and mTOR inhibition profile is shared by several of the most promising longevity compounds studied in laboratory settings.
The PMC 2025 review highlighted berberine’s epigenetic mechanisms — its ability to influence DNA methylation and histone modification patterns — as a frontier area of research that may explain its broader anti-aging potential. Source: PMC/NIH
While large-scale human longevity trials are still lacking, the mechanistic evidence positions berberine as one of the more scientifically credible natural longevity compounds currently available.
How Much Berberine Should You Take?
| Goal | Dose | Timing | Notes |
|---|---|---|---|
| Blood sugar control | 500mg x 3/day | With meals | Split dosing reduces GI side effects |
| Weight / metabolic support | 500mg x 2–3/day | With meals | Consistent daily use for 8+ weeks |
| Cholesterol / heart | 500mg x 2–3/day | With meals | Effects build over 2–3 months |
| PCOS | 500mg x 3/day | With meals | Under medical supervision |
| Longevity / anti-aging | 500mg x 2/day | With meals | Cycling recommended |
Total daily dose: 1,000–1,500mg, split across 2–3 meals. Taking the full dose at once dramatically increases the risk of GI side effects and reduces effectiveness due to berberine’s short half-life (approximately 2–4 hours).
Cycling protocol: Most practitioners recommend 8 weeks on, 2–4 weeks off. The rationale is twofold — to prevent tolerance and to allow the gut microbiome (which berberine significantly modulates) to rebalance periodically.
When to expect results: Blood sugar improvements can appear within 2 weeks. Cholesterol and weight changes typically require 8–12 weeks of consistent use.

Berberine vs. Metformin: How Do They Compare?
Berberine and metformin share the same primary mechanism — AMPK activation — which is why they produce similar effects on blood sugar and insulin sensitivity. Multiple head-to-head trials have found comparable reductions in fasting glucose and HbA1c between the two compounds in people with type 2 diabetes or prediabetes.
Where berberine has advantages: - Available without a prescription - May have additional benefits (cholesterol, gut microbiome, longevity pathways) beyond blood sugar - Lower risk of vitamin B12 depletion (a known metformin side effect with long-term use) - Generally similar or better GI tolerability at standard doses
Where metformin has advantages: - Decades of safety data in diabetic populations - More potent at reducing blood glucose in people with established type 2 diabetes - Standardized pharmaceutical-grade dosing and regulation - Covered by insurance
UCLA Health’s senior clinical dietitian Dana Ellis Hunnes, PhD, is clear: berberine is not a replacement for metformin in people with diabetes who have been prescribed medication. But for people with prediabetes, insulin resistance, or metabolic syndrome who are not yet on medication, berberine offers a well-studied natural alternative worth discussing with a doctor. Source: UCLA Health
Berberine Side Effects and Who Should Avoid It
Berberine is generally well tolerated at standard doses. The most common issues are GI-related and typically resolve after the first 1–2 weeks.
Common side effects: - Nausea, cramping, diarrhea, constipation, or bloating — particularly in the first two weeks. Always take with food. - Low blood sugar (hypoglycemia) — possible if you are also taking diabetes medication or skipping meals - Heart rhythm effects — rare at standard doses, but relevant for people with arrhythmia
Who should avoid berberine: - Pregnant or breastfeeding women — berberine can cross the placenta and may harm fetal development - Infants and young children — not safe - People taking diabetes medications — additive blood sugar lowering can cause hypoglycemia; consult your doctor before combining - People on blood thinners (warfarin, aspirin) - People taking blood pressure or anti-arrhythmic medications - People with liver or kidney disease — berberine is metabolized by the liver and excreted renally
A January 2026 safety review noted that long-term safety data beyond 6 months is still limited, and product quality varies significantly across brands. Source: Ubie Health
GoodRx confirms that berberine is considered safe at doses up to 1.5g per day but advises consulting a healthcare provider before starting — particularly for people managing blood sugar, blood pressure, or taking prescription medications. Source: GoodRx
FAQ
What does berberine actually do? Berberine activates AMPK — the body’s master metabolic regulator — improving insulin sensitivity, lowering blood sugar, reducing fat storage, and triggering cellular cleanup processes linked to longevity.
How long does berberine take to work? Blood sugar improvements can appear within 2 weeks. Cholesterol, weight, and body composition changes typically require 8–12 weeks of consistent daily use.
Is berberine really “nature’s Ozempic”? The comparison is misleading. Berberine and GLP-1 medications like Ozempic work through entirely different mechanisms and berberine produces far more modest results in terms of weight loss. That said, berberine does have meaningful, clinically validated metabolic benefits — it just requires realistic expectations.
Can you take berberine every day? Yes, but cycling is recommended. Most practitioners suggest 8 weeks on, followed by a 2–4 week break to prevent tolerance and support gut microbiome balance.
Should berberine be taken with food? Always. Taking berberine on an empty stomach significantly increases GI side effects. Splitting the daily dose across 2–3 meals is the most effective and comfortable approach.
Can berberine replace metformin? For people already prescribed metformin for diabetes, no — do not replace a prescription medication without consulting your doctor. For people with prediabetes or insulin resistance not yet on medication, berberine may be a viable natural option to discuss with your healthcare provider.
Is berberine safe long term? Short-term safety (up to 6 months) is well-established. Long-term data beyond that is limited. Cycling — rather than indefinite daily use — is the currently recommended approach.
